The homes, apartments, and overall atmosphere of Waterford are undeniably New England. The town’s proximity to the Long Island Sound mean there’s an emphasis on seafood and coastal living, especially in the summer. New London shares a border on the east, and Waterford itself is less than an hour from both New Haven and Providence.

Residents enjoy a vibrant landscape of lush foliage and trees, and there’s an incredible variety of local eateries in Central Waterford. The emphasis on greenery doesn’t stop at the water. There’s a number of parks that are perfect for renters and their canine friends, and Harkness Memorial State Park if you’re looking to take a longer hike.

Besides the easy access to the water, renting an apartment in Waterford also puts you close to the incredible character of New England. With I-95 and I-395 nearby, you can explore the rest of the region easily.

Rent Trends

As of March 2026, the average apartment rent in Waterford, CT is $1,406 for one bedroom, and $2,184 for two bedrooms. Apartment rent in Waterford has increased by 1.8% in the past year.
